Senior Finance AnalystThe Senior Finance Analyst will play a pivotal role in bridging finance and operations, with a strong focus on cost accounting and operational performance.Own and deliver detailed cost analysis across materials, labour, and overheadsPartner closely with Operations and Supply Chain to drive efficiency and performance improvementsLead variance analysis, including production, yield, and inventory performanceSupport month-end close processes, including inventory and cost of goods sold reportingAssist with budgeting, forecasting, and financial modelling activitiesPlay a key role in audit processes (internal and external) and inventory controlsAct as a change agent on systems and process improvements, including ERP transformation projectsMPI does not discriminate on the basis of race, color, religion, sex, sexual orientation, gender identity or expression, national origin, age, disability, veteran status, marital status, or based on an individual's status in any group or class protected by applicable federal, state or local law. MPI encourages applications from minorities, women, the disabled, protected veterans, and all other qualified applicants.For the Senior Finance Analyst role we are seeking: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field3-5+ years of progressive finance experience within a manufacturing environmentStrong cost accounting experience, ideally within process manufacturingExperience using ERP systems SAP is strongly preferredProven ability to analyse complex data and translate into actionable insightsStrong stakeholder management skills, with experience partnering with Operations teamsProactive, self-starting mindset with the ability to drive improvements and influence changeWhat's on offer:Competitive salary ranging from $71,000 to $95,000 USD.Opportunity to earn a 10% bonus.Comprehensive benefits package to support your well-being.Work in the FMCG industry with a focus on innovation and growth.Collaborative and supportive work environment.Permanent role with opportunities for professional development.If you're ready to take the next step in your career as a Senior Finance Analyst, we encourage you to apply today!M

The role of a recruitment consultancy is to act as an intermediary, identifying and sourcing suitably qualified candidates on behalf of its clients. Candidates are recruited either for permanent or contract positions (typically for a fixed term) or on a temporary basis. Within the overall recruitment industry, the market for professional recruitment services is a specialist sector which has developed more recently.
